Of the 56 ministers in the current Modi government, 24 have roots in the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ad (ABVP). Among BJP CMs, 13 of the 28 who have served since 2014 have an ABVP background. And all the three CMs appointed by the BJP this month — in Rajasthan, Madhya Pradesh and Chhattisgarh — found their political footing in the RSS-BJP student wing. In Ep 1373 of Cut The Clutter, Editor-in-Chief Shekhar Gupta talks about the clout of ABVP alumni in Indian politics, and why it is India's ‘top school of politics'.----more----Read Neelam Pandey and Amogh Rohmetra article here: https://theprint.in/politics/amit-shah-rajnath-to-gadkari-fadnavis-how-abvp-emerged-as-the-cradle-of-bjp-leadership/1900336/

Do you know about the Navnirman Andolan? Gujarat 1973-74? Okay, you would not know... but PM Narendra Modi, he must know... because he was a part of it... A student strike against a fee hike in hostel food, became such a massive agitation against corruption across Gujarat, that in 3 months it led to the fall of Congress CM Chimanbhai Patel and his government. In 1975 too, during the Emergency, as a student and RSS pracharak, Modi organised protests in Gujarat, spending months underground. At the same time, in Delhi, his late colleague, Arun Jaitley, then a firebrand ABVP leader and DU Student Union President, was jailed for leading anti-Emergency protests. Across India, thousands of students, many inspired by Jaiprakash Narayan, were on the streets – among them young Nitish Kumar, Lalu Yadav and Mulayam Singh – all youth leaders then. So, what's my point? The point is that for students to protest, agitate, express dissent against what they see to be wrong, is in a student's DNA! When they are young, idealistic, sensitive, aware of what's going on around them, and have a strong view about it, when they are full of energy, and unafraid, then, of course, they will PROTEST! Yeh Jo India Hai Na… whether it was a 100 years ago, in our freedom struggle, or 45 years ago during the Emergency, or just months ago, during the Anti-CAA-NRC protests, whether it was Modi and Arun Jaitley then... or Safoora Zargar and Meeran Haidar today... students have been India's conscience keepers, and they must continue to do that. More than 60 students – aged between 9 and 11 – have been interrogated at least four times by police in the last one week. The interrogation – and the overall investigation – is over a play, a school play to be specific, which was critical of the citizenship law. As these young kids performed the play at their annual school function, it offended an ABVP activist and has since been tagged "seditious".No matter how bizarre this sounds...young kids interrogated....for a play....all of it is true. The school is Shaheen Urdu Primary School, located in Karnataka's Bidar, and part of Muslim-affiliated Shaheen Group of Institutions. And a single mother of an 11-year-old student and a teacher at the school are behind bars on charges of sedition over the so-called anti-CAA play.Sedition seems to be India's favourite charge against its people. But is India suddenly buzzing with people who are disloyal towards the nation, who are the enemies of the state? Or is the state misusing the sedition laws against its own people? A shocking explosion of violence broke out in New Delhi’s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U) on Sunday night, 5 January 2020, when armed and masked groups muscled their way into the university campus, entered student’s hostels and attacked students violently with rods and stones. The JNU Teachers’ Association and the JNU Students’ Union have both blamed the JNU administration, specifically the vice chancellor, seeking his removal. Testimony from students and teachers at the university campus has pointed to an organised attack perpetrated by activists associated with the ruling Bharatiya Janata Party and its student affiliate the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ad (ABVP). While the government declared there will be an inquiry into the violence, some union ministers, along with the ABVP and other rightwing formations, have already blamed the leftwing student organisations within JNU. In this episode of Himal Interviews, our Editor Aunohita Mojumdar talks to scholar and activist Nivedita Menon, who is a Professor of Political Thought at Jawaharlal Nehru University. Menon speaks about the night of the attack, the administration’s complicity in the violence, and the possibilities of resistance.

On Sunday, January 5th 2020, a masked mob comprising over 40-50 people armed with iron rods, sticks and stones stormed one of Delhi's most esteemed universities, Jawaharlal Nehru University and attacked students and teachers. Aishe Ghosh, JNU Students Union President was brutally beaten up by masked men. Over 23 students and one professor Sucharita Sen were among those injured. According to multiple news reports, the right wing student group ABVP and its members were behind the attacks. According to eyewitnesses, including many journalists, the attacks took place under the noses of Delhi police who as per videos which have surfaced also escorted some attackers outside the campus. A whatsapp group where the attack was allegedly coordinated also points fingers towards ABVP with one of its members accepting on prime time news that ABVP had asked the students to arm itself. Delhi police has once again come under attack for siding with the administration & for dereliction of duty. ABVP on the other hand accuses the Left student body for orchestrating the attacks and pinning it on them.  Yogendra Yadav, President of Swaraj India and activist was also manhandled outside the university campus on Sunday evening where he had reached upon receiving news of the attacks.  For this episode of The Suno India Show, our researcher, Kunika Balhotra reached out to Yogendra Yadav to know why the JNU attack took place and more.  For more stories like this, you can listen to www.sunoindia.in. What is the sense in this term?”Elaborating on the term, Saikat says, “If you look at Maoist literature...they have a lot of literature on urban warfare but they look at it from a military terminology, where they look at how to conduct urban operations, both, which will include psychological operations, information operations as well as military operations but they look at it from a very military perspective and that kind of literature is available.”  He further says, “Even the Naxals themselves or the Maoists have never talked about anything called ‘urban Maoist’ as a separate phenomenon because for them, class warfare is across -- whether rural or urban.” He adds, “This is a deliberate political term which some people of the Right have brought to discredit just about anybody who challenges their narrative.”Saif speaks of two writers, Arun Ferriera and Vernon Gonsalves, being arrested in 2007 on similar grounds. "Again, some letters were leaked and Arun was supposed to be, according to Maharashtra Police, one of the Communications experts. So he was arrested. And the trial went on for four years. And these leaked letters never even made it to the trial. So it was just about painting a certain narrative of a certain individual. Vernon was arrested in August 2007. And again, the trial went on for seven years. And he was supposed to be one of the people handling the finances of the Maoists.”He further adds, “Interestingly, there was a Narco analysis that was done on Arun Ferreira in which according to the leaks he had said it was the Shiv Sena and ABVP that had paid them...At that time it was the Congress and 2009 General Elections. Right now, you’re looking at 2019.”Raman says, “I think it was completely a plant! And 2019 elections, this was more for persecuting people rather than prosecuting.”Saikat says, “Here you have a plot allegedly to kill the Prime Minister, forget about the NIA, even the Central Bureau of Investigation has not been brought in.”  He adds, “Nobody’s talking about bringing in the Intelligence Bureau, nobody’s talking about bringing in the NIA or the CBI.
